Mastering the Chords: Playing "I Like Me Better When I'm With You"

Now, for all you aspiring musicians out there, let's talk "I Like Me Better When I'm With You" chords. The beauty of this track lies in its accessibility. Lauv tends to craft songs with chords that are generally beginner-friendly, and this one is no exception. This makes it a fantastic song to learn if you're just picking up the guitar or sitting down at a piano for the first time. The core of the song typically revolves around a few common major and minor chords. On guitar, you'll likely find yourself playing chords like G, C, D, and Em. These are some of the most fundamental chords in popular music, meaning if you've ever dabbled in learning guitar, you've probably already encountered them. The progression is often repetitive in the verses and choruses, which is what gives the song its signature catchy feel and makes it relatively easy to memorize. For example, a common progression you might see is G-D-Em-C. This sequence is a workhorse in pop music for a reason – it sounds good, it’s satisfying to play, and it supports melodies beautifully. The rhythm is also key. The song has a consistent, driving beat that’s easy to lock into. When you’re strumming, aim for a steady down-up pattern, perhaps emphasizing the downbeats slightly to match the song's pulse. For pianists, the chords translate similarly. You'll be playing the same root notes, often with simple block chords or arpeggiated patterns to create the song's texture. The synth melodies in the original track can be mimicked with simple lead lines or sustained chords on the piano. The beauty of learning the "I Like Me Better When I'm With You" chords is that once you nail the main progression, you've essentially got the whole song. Variations might exist in bridges or instrumental breaks, but the foundation remains solid. Many online resources provide detailed chord charts and diagrams, often showing specific strumming patterns for guitar or voicings for piano. Don't be afraid to look these up! Seeing the visual representation of the chords and the suggested rhythm can make all the difference. Practice slowly at first. Focus on clean chord changes – making sure each note rings out clearly without buzzing. Once you’re comfortable with the transitions, gradually increase your speed until you can play along with the recording. The goal isn't just to play the notes; it's to capture the feeling of the song. Lauv's delivery is light and buoyant, so try to reflect that in your playing. A slightly brighter tone on guitar or a more flowing feel on the piano can really bring the song to life. Tips for Learning and Performing

So you've got the lyrics, you've got the chords – now what? Let's talk about how to make learning and performing "I Like Me Better When I'm With You" lyrics and chords even better! First off, listen actively. Don't just have the song on in the background. Really pay attention to Lauv's vocal delivery. Notice the nuances in his tone, the way he emphasizes certain words, and the overall emotion he conveys. This will help you understand the vibe you want to capture when you play it. Next, practice in sections. Don't try to tackle the whole song at once. Master the verse, then the pre-chorus, then the chorus. Once you feel solid on each part, start linking them together. This makes the learning process less daunting and builds momentum. Use a metronome! I know, I know, it can be a buzzkill sometimes, but trust me, it's your best friend for developing a solid sense of rhythm and timing. Start slow and gradually increase the tempo as you get more comfortable. For guitarists, focus on smooth chord transitions. Practice switching between the chords (like G to C, or Em to D) repeatedly until it feels fluid. Muting strings accidentally or struggling to get the change in time can break the flow, so dedicate specific practice time to just those transitions. If you're playing piano, work on your voicings and rhythm. Are you playing block chords? Arpeggios? Experiment to see what sounds best and fits the song's feel. The original track has some cool synth lines; try to replicate simple versions of those if you can! Sing while you play, even if you're not confident in your singing voice. This is crucial for connecting the lyrics to the music and getting the phrasing right. It might feel awkward at first, but it’s essential for a genuine performance. Record yourself! This is probably the most underutilized tip, guys. Listening back to your own playing and singing is invaluable for identifying areas that need improvement – things you might not notice while you're in the moment. You'll catch awkward pauses, missed notes, or timing issues much more easily. Finally, perform it for someone. Whether it's a friend, family member, or even just your pet, performing for an audience (even a small one) helps you get comfortable playing under pressure and gives you valuable feedback.
